Web15 sep. 2024 · 3. Incorrect installation. If your dishwasher is making loud noises, it may be due to incorrect installation. There are a few things you can check to see if your dishwasher is installed properly. First, check to make sure that the dishwasher is level. If it’s not level, it can cause the dishwasher to vibrate and make noise. Web1 feb. 2024 · A piece of broken dish or glassware or a stuck food particle could cause a grinding noise when the pump drains water. Clearing the chopper blade of any debris should solve the problem. However, to access the blade, the drain pump housing must be removed, as well as the dishwasher’s impeller.
